confused clown

I have a pair of false perc clowns. I have had them about 2 months now and they are doing great.
About a week ago I bought a carpet anemone for them to (hopefully) host to, realizing it may take a while because of the fact they were tank raised.
Yesterday, one of the clowns started hosting! yay! ...problem being it is hosting to my really small frogspawn coral:S
I am wondering if it will damage the coral as it rubs it against its skeleton. Also, do you think the second clown will go to the coral as well? Is it normal for a "pair" to sleep in seperate parts of the tank?
Thanks guys! Appreciate the advice as always

Re: confused clown

Their called clowns for a reason.You never know what their gonna host.
I used to have a seba that loved xenia.
It'd be a good idea to keep an eye on the carpet anemone to.They've been know to use the hosting clowns as a snack.

Re: confused clown

Good luck,you're braver than I am.

Frogspawns are pretty tough corals,generally they can handle a clown hosting them.The clowns are a ''pair'' but are they ''paired up'' or a ''mated pair''.It's never a guarantee that buying two clowns will ever become a ''mated pair''.,..only time will tell.

Re: confused clown

Nice looking anemone. No guarantee that the clown will ever host it. One of my clowns will host whatever kind of coral I put near her territory. The other hosts one of my koralias. I introduced the two of them separately (about 3 years apart from each other), and they have never paired up. There is no guarantee that your clowns will ever take to any sort of anemone. Like others have said, watch that carpet. They are probably the worst anemone when it comes to eating fish. I saw one in the LFS eat its own clown once!! At first I was sad, but then I laughed.
